Full job description
Role Overview:
We're looking for an experienced and highly technical Still Life Creative Photographer to join our Creative Services team.
This is an exciting opportunity for a photographer with exceptional still life expertise, particularly in beauty and jewellery, who can create premium imagery that reflects Liberty's distinctive aesthetic. You'll combine advanced technical skills with a refined creative eye to produce exceptional photography across both digital and print channels.
If you're passionate about art, design and craftsmanship, thrive in a collaborative creative environment, and have a portfolio that demonstrates outstanding still life work, we'd love to hear from you.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Produce premium still life imagery using advanced photographic techniques, ensuring the highest standards of quality, consistency and technical excellence.
-
Design and execute sophisticated lighting setups to create polished, visually compelling photography.
-
Capture beauty and jewellery products with exceptional attention to detail, expertly handling reflective materials and premium finishes.
-
Style objects and direct subjects on set to create strong, well-composed imagery.
-
Deliver creative briefs efficiently while managing multiple shoots and collaborating closely with the Head of Creative and Art Directors.
-
Edit imagery using industry-standard software, maintaining consistency across all assets. Retouching experience is advantageous and will support collaboration with our retouching team.
-
Maintain photographic equipment, lighting systems and the London studio to ensure they remain organised and production-ready.
-
Manage digital assets and contribute to efficient studio workflows and file management processes.
-
Participate in creative discussions and work collaboratively across cross-functional creative teams in a fast-paced environment.
-
Support wider business photography requirements, including events, store openings, pop-ups and artist visits.
About You:
You'll bring a combination of creative vision, technical expertise and meticulous attention to detail, along with:
-
A strong portfolio demonstrating exceptional still life photography, ideally including beauty and jewellery.
-
A Bachelor's degree or a minimum of five years' experience within a professional photographic studio.
-
Advanced knowledge of professional camera systems, lenses, lighting equipment and photographic workflows.
-
High proficiency in Photoshop and Capture One.
-
Retouching skills are desirable.
-
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
-
The ability to manage multiple projects while meeting tight deadlines.
-
A proactive approach with a genuine drive for creative excellence.
Additional Information:
This role will occasionally require travel outside our London studio. From time to time, evening, weekend or Bank Holiday working may be required to support business needs and production deadlines.
Please submit your photographic portfolio with your application. Your portfolio should be strongly weighted towards still life photography, with particular emphasis on beauty and jewellery work.
Shortlisted candidates will be invited to complete a live photographic task as part of the interview process.
